黑马Mybatis框架学习
记录自己Mybatis框架的学习
NJUSTZJC
这个作者很懒,什么都没留下…
展开
-
Mybatis动态SQL之删除一个和批量删除功能
Mybatis中删除功能删除一个批量删除collection 中填入的是哪个数组。@Param指向的参数。item代表的是哪个属性。separator代表的是分隔符。原创 2021-12-11 20:47:09 · 232 阅读 · 0 评论 -
Mybatis中动态SQL之动态修改字段功能
Mybatis中修改字段delete的使用普通修改功能动态修改功能原创 2021-12-11 20:27:21 · 905 阅读 · 0 评论 -
resultMap结果映射的使用(多表查询的时候使用)
resultMap结果映射的使用原创 2022-02-03 10:47:25 · 645 阅读 · 0 评论 -
SQL动态SQL之where和foreach标签的使用( 应用场景为in(?,?,?) )
SQL动态查询之foreach标签的使用( 应用场景为in(?,?,?) )代码,复制过来直接使用 <select id="selectByIds" resultType="user" parameterType="list"> select * from user<where> <foreach collection="list" open="id in (" close=")" item="id" separator=",">原创 2022-01-31 10:18:46 · 1702 阅读 · 0 评论 -
SQL动态SQL之多条件动态查询中where标签和if test的使用
SQL多条件动态查询 <where> <if test=" status != null"> status = #{status} </if> <if test="brandName != null and brandName != ''"> and brand_name like #{brandName}原创 2021-12-01 23:36:53 · 2054 阅读 · 0 评论 -
Mybatis中sqlsession的创建及其sql的使用(代理接口的开发方式)
Mybatis中sqlsession的创建及其sql的使用sqlsession的创建代码,复制直接使用 InputStream inputStream = Resources.getResourceAsStream("mybatis-config.xml"); SqlSessionFactory sqlSessionFactory = new SqlSessionFactoryBuilder().build(inputStream); SqlSessi原创 2022-01-30 13:24:37 · 1411 阅读 · 0 评论 -
Mybatis核心配置文件编写
Mybatis核心配置文件编写代码,直接复制直接用<?xml version="1.0" encoding="UTF-8" ?><!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ybatis.org/dtd/mybatis-3-config.dtd"><configuration><!-- 配置jdbc.prop原创 2022-01-30 13:13:19 · 224 阅读 · 0 评论 -
Mybatis中SQL映射文件编写(代理接口的开发方式)
Mybatis映射文件编写步骤代码<?xml version="1.0" encoding="UTF-8" ?><!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"><mapper namespace="userMapper"> <select id="sel原创 2022-01-30 12:32:13 · 1664 阅读 · 0 评论 -
使用Mybatis框架要导入的包
Mybatis框架快速入门导入依赖原创 2022-01-30 11:37:53 · 934 阅读 · 0 评论